Compare all specifications:
1966 Autobianchi Bianchina | 1976 Suzuki LJ 50 | |
Make | Autobianchi | Suzuki |
Model | Bianchina | LJ 50 |
Year Released | 1966 | 1976 |
Engine Position | Rear | Front |
Engine Size | 499 cc | 539 cc |
Engine Cylinders | 2 cylinders | 3 cylinders |
Engine Type | in-line | in-line |
Horse Power | 18 HP | 0 HP |
Torque | 30 Nm | 52 Nm |
Torque RPM | 2800 RPM | 3000 RPM |
Fuel Type | Gasoline | Gasoline |
Drive Type | Rear | 4WD |
Transmission Type | Manual | Manual |
Vehicle Weight | 564 kg | 695 kg |
Vehicle Length | 3190 mm | 3280 mm |
Vehicle Width | 1330 mm | 1420 mm |
Vehicle Height | 1340 mm | 1690 mm |
Wheelbase Size | 1950 mm | 1940 mm |
